Hot water sizing for single-bathroom homes

A home with one bathroom and no separate en-suite has relatively simple hot water demand compared with a house running two showers at once, which usually points towards a straightforward combi boiler rather than a larger stored hot water system.

A single-bathroom home: engineer's shortlist

  • A single bathroom rarely needs simultaneous high-flow hot water outlets
  • Combi boilers are commonly suited to this kind of household demand pattern
  • Boiler output is still sized against total radiator heat loss, not just hot water
  • Shower type and flow rate are checked against the boiler's rated output
  • Freeing up cylinder cupboard space is a common reason to switch to combi here

Where a single-bathroom home usually comes from

With one bathroom in regular use, a combi boiler sized to the property's heat loss and typical flow rate needs usually meets demand without a hot water cylinder taking up cupboard space. The main sizing consideration becomes the number of radiators and the property's overall heat loss, rather than juggling simultaneous demand from multiple bathrooms, which is where larger stored systems tend to be considered instead.

Questions we get asked

Is a combi always right for one bathroom?
It's often suitable, but heat loss and hot water flow needs are still checked before confirming the appliance type.
What if I might add an en-suite later?
It's worth mentioning at survey stage, since future demand can influence which boiler size or type makes the most sense now.
